Output 6e36d542a406a3b4102df3ea6443d5ffc9fe52de9593845bb9fda1124661b090:23

value
690227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0b56d93d3d93427cd83918e651ef64616cd97e OP_EQUAL
address
3HHR4DEoufujgA9Pv2QYaQChVqjby5Vjte
transaction
6e36d542a406a3b4102df3ea6443d5ffc9fe52de9593845bb9fda1124661b090
confirmations
176600
spent
true